在使用 Vue.js 开发视频网站时,一个常见的问题就是跨域问题。跨域问题是指,由于浏览器的同源策略限制,不同域名之间的 JavaScript 无法直接访问对方的资源。为了解决这个问题,可以采取以下几种方法:
要在 Vue.js 中实现视频播放器的功能,可以使用第三方库如 video.js 或 DPlayer。这些库提供丰富的 API 和功能,包括播放控制、进度条、音量调节、全屏等。可以通过在 Vue 组件中引入和配置这些库,实现视频播放器的各种交互功能。还可以根据项目的需求,自定义播放器的样式和行为。
在使用 Vue.js 开发视频网站时,跨域问题和视频播放器功能是两个需要重点关注的问题。通过采用合适的跨域处理方法,如 CORS、Nginx 反向代理、Webpack 代理等,可以解决跨域问题。而对于视频播放器的实现,则可以依赖于第三方库如 video.js 或 DPlayer,利用其提供的丰富 API 和功能,实现视频的各种交互和自定义功能。通过这两方面的实现,可以为视频网站提供良好的用户体验。